Old 23rd October 2018, 18:39   #1
Pawel
Moderator
 
Pawel's Avatar
 
Join Date: Aug 2004
Location: Poland
Posts: 518
Send a message via ICQ to Pawel
Request for Test and Opinion [WINAMP TOOLS]

I would like to ask you to help with tests. Would be nice if you try it and write your opinion.
What would you add in such applications, what would you change. Is it working fine for you?
Thanks for any opinion. Version 10.0.0.10 of Winamp Tools applications brings many changes and I hope it made it super easy to use and very simple.

For now 2 Winamp Tools applications are available:


ALL ABOUT WINAMP (WAAbout)
Link: http://www.meggamusic.co.uk/shup/1547025383/WAAbout.exe

WINAMP BACKUP & RESTORE (WABackupRestore)
Link: http://www.meggamusic.co.uk/shup/154...kupRestore.exe


Let me tell you something about Winamp Tools Project (https://www.pawelporwisz.pl/winamp/winamp_tools_en.php). Winamp Tools is a set of tools dedicated to Winamp. I started to write this very long time ago (first, it was just tool that helped me to organize translation for Winamp).
Over time, the program and all related files became more and more advanced. After many years of changes, improvements, writing new ideas, removing this ideas I created apps you can see now.
Today, all my simple helper applications, scripts or bath files bacame a Winamp Tools package. Winamp Tools consists of the following apps:

- All About Winamp (WAAbout): This application allows you to get and display all important information about Winamp,
- Winamp Backup & Restore (WABackupRestore): This application allows you to create backup of all Winamp files and settings and if it is neccessary restore it,
- Winamp Translation (WATranslator): This application allows you to simplify and organize Winamp interface translation. It is possibly to generate Winamp Language Pack (it is a wrapper for lng_generator, external application written by DrO).

At the begining, all this apps was written to complete so called Winamp PL project (Polish Language Pack, Polish Winamp help system and everything related with Winamp for Polish user). Few years ago, I thought it can be used by all Winamp users (this is why it support english language now).

Notes:
I have to notice that some time ago I was helping Koopa with his similar Winamp related tools (written in NSIS): Winamp Info Tool or Winamp Backup Tool (and other things). I was responsible for some graphics, some ideas and a lot of code... but, we decided both to not continue our cooperation. Later, I wrote my own backup tool based on his idea (and added it to my other applications).
The main reason to write my own application was a different look at the matter, limited script possibilities, etc...It seems, however, that for some the existence of two similar applications is too much... If you want to try it out, here is a link to his tools: http://koopa.meggamusic.co.uk/

Let me describe shortly each tool:

---------------------------------------------
ALL ABOUT WINAMP (WAAbout)
---------------------------------------------

All About Winamp (WAAbout) is a simple and intuitive tool that allows you to gather and display information about Winamp. It can create report using simple wizard, you can manage your existing reports and finally you can just display the most important Winamp informations. The most important feature is possibility to create report (in text format - clear and simple text, or in HTML format - formatted, nice-looking document with images) with all important information about Winamp and its components.

It is written in Delphi, modern programming environment with convenient and fast compiler (now also 64bit). This allows to write whatever you want (the only problem is relatively big exe files produced by Delphi... but nowadays it seems not be a big deal (especially with UPX)).

I know that for many this program may be useless or completely unnecessary, but I hope that someone will find it useful (I love it! :P).

All About Winamp (WAAbout) application supports command-line options and exit error codes. Command-line options can help you to automate some actions or replace saved settings without changing it. Exit error codes can help you to diagnose the problem if something goes wrong (if /S command is passed and there is no visible information). Commands can be entered in upper or lower case. You should always use quotation marks for commands data. Passed paths need to be a fully qualified paths to work correctly.

To get to know all command-line options use in console: WAAbout.exe /?


---------------------------------------------
WINAMP BACKUP & RESTORE (WABackupRestore)
---------------------------------------------

Winamp Backup & Restore (WABackupRestore) application allows you to create a backup of all Winamp settings and files and if it is neccessary restore it. It is simple and intuitive application. It is designed to backup specific (or all) Winamp settings and files. Created backup file can be restored at any time. It is an invaluable tool for users who like to experiment with the settings or for those who simply want to backup Winamp files.

Winamp Backup & Restore application has an intuitive and simple interface, small size, is portable, compatible with Windows 7+. Thanks to preferences, allows you to customize it. It allows to generate detailed TXT/HTML reports for chosen actions and support several languages.

Winamp Backup & Restore runs in two modes - BACKUP and RESTORE.
BACKUP MODE
Backup mode allows to make a backup of all Winamp files and settings (user need to choose Winamp Installation Directory or directroy where Portable Winamp is located, define output backup directory, its filename, etc (you may use default), define report options and thats all.
Notes: You can make Full Backup or Normal Backup (Full is recommended).

RESTORE MODE
Restore Mode allows you to restore files from previously created Backup File into default Winamp Installation Directory (or defined by user).
To restore the files you need to choose Winamp Backup File (with wbr extension), choose output (destination) directory, define some report options and thats all!


Winamp Backup & Restore (WABackupRestore) application supports command-line options and exit error codes. Command-line options can help you to automate some actions. Exit error codes can help you to diagnose the problem if something goes wrong (if /S parameter is passed and there is no visible information).

Commands can be entered in upper or lower case. You should always use quotation marks for commands data. Passed paths need to be a fully qualified paths to work correctly. There are two basic actions: Backup (/BACKUP) and Restore (/RESTORE). Each action has specific commands that must be passed with it. There are also General and Report command-line options (optional, used both in Backup and Restore actions).

To get to know all command-line options use in console: WABackupRestore.exe /?

---


Notes: By default all backup files and generated reports are stored in the user directory. Settings are stored in:
All About Winamp (WAAbout):
C:\Users\USER_NAME\AppData\Roaming\Winamp Tools\WAAbout\WAAbout.ini
Winamp Backup & Restore (WABackupRestore):
C:\Users\USER_NAME\AppData\Roaming\Winamp Tools\WABackupRestore\WABackupRestore.ini

You can force using portable mode by changing config option in configuration file:

code:
[SYSTEM]
; App Configuration Files Mode [0=Portable | 1=User Directory]
UserMode=1 ; change to UserMode=0 to use application as portable
; App Default Language [1033 | 1045]
DefaultLang=1033





I hope this info is clear and maybe you will even find useful to use my Winamp Tools
-Pawel

Last edited by Pawel; 9th January 2019 at 09:17.
Pawel is offline   Reply With Quote
Old 24th October 2018, 19:46   #2
PeterK.
Quinto Black CT Developer
 
Join Date: Sep 2016
Posts: 569
Hello Pawel,

now this is a great piece of software!

I just ran a short test and must admit that I am impressed. It looks and feels very stable. Everything is in its proper place and looks (almost) very clean on my high-resolution display. Every text line is big enough. No cut off sentences or graphics. The whole appearance of the program is very nice.

Exported report also looks very good in my Firefox.

Two notes though:

1) in the tab SKINS the additional info about the skin is missing. Also there is no preview screenshot. And all this because Winamp does not provide those text lines at all. (only during installation). When you hit CTRL+P and go to Skins tab you will only find the name of the current skin. Nothing more. Is this actually a bug?

2)Those three icons in the status bar (Options, Help and Create Report) are definitely too small. And all other seem "pixelated"/"edgy"- as if your program zoomed in a 48x48 icon format into 150x150. Please have a look at the attached screenshot. In case those are real icon files you might add some more formats to those icons. And if these are just png files - well, you have to keep it that way.

Would it be possible to add svg files to your program?

Once again, great job Pawel.

Last edited by PeterK.; 25th October 2018 at 06:27.
PeterK. is offline   Reply With Quote
Old 24th October 2018, 20:41   #3
Pawel
Moderator
 
Pawel's Avatar
 
Join Date: Aug 2004
Location: Poland
Posts: 518
Send a message via ICQ to Pawel
Quote:
Originally Posted by PeterK. View Post

Hello Pawel,

now this is a great piece of software!
Thanks!

Quote:
Originally Posted by PeterK. View Post

1) in the tab SKINS the additional info about the skin is missing. Also there is no preview screenshot. And all this because Winamp does not provide those text lines at all. (only during installation). When you hit CTRL+P and go to Skins tab you will only find the name of the current skin. Nothing more. Is this actually a bug?
If I understand it well, it is on purpose. Some skins listed in "Skins" tab do not have description (like for example built-in Classic Skin or zipped skins).
I could read info from zipped skins, but I decided to not do this for now (I would have to add zip support and unzipping it in runtime just to read some info...)


Quote:
Originally Posted by PeterK. View Post

2)Those three icons in the status bar (Options, Help and Create Report) are definitely too small. And all other seem "pixelated"/"edgy"- as if your program zoomed in a 48x48 icon format into 150x150. Please have a look at the attached screenshot. In case those are real icon files you might add some more formats to those icons. And if these are just png files - well, you have to keep it that way.
Yes. For now, this icons are always 16x16, even in High DPI screen (for example with scaling set to 150%)
I will work on images on buttons later (for now these are bitmaps).


Quote:
Originally Posted by PeterK. View Post

Would it be possible to add svg files to your program?
No. I use PNG format and this is not gonna change.


Thanks for testing. Did you however tested the latest build (v.10)? I see on your screenshots old version, 9.0 - that is completely different and OLD.
I linked the newest version at the top of the post (do not download it from my website).

-Pawel
Pawel is offline   Reply With Quote
Old 24th October 2018, 21:15   #4
PeterK.
Quinto Black CT Developer
 
Join Date: Sep 2016
Posts: 569
Quote:
Originally Posted by Pawel View Post
... Did you however tested the latest build (v.10)? I see on your screenshots old version, 9.0 - that is completely different and OLD.
I linked the newest version at the top of the post (do not download it from my website)...
I am so sorry, you are right. I followed the second link, visited your homepage, found the "special website" and grabbed the 9.0 version of your program.

And the version 10 looks even better! I see that you removed the icons at the bottom of the window and all other ones look gorgeous!
PeterK. is offline   Reply With Quote
Old 25th October 2018, 09:20   #5
Pawel
Moderator
 
Pawel's Avatar
 
Join Date: Aug 2004
Location: Poland
Posts: 518
Send a message via ICQ to Pawel
Peter,
You use none-standard Windows scaling, right? What DPI?
(My app support 100%, 125%, 150% and 200%).

-Pawel
Pawel is offline   Reply With Quote
Old 25th October 2018, 09:42   #6
PeterK.
Quinto Black CT Developer
 
Join Date: Sep 2016
Posts: 569
Quote:
Originally Posted by Pawel View Post
Peter,
You use none-standard Windows scaling, right? What DPI?
The scaling is set to 150 %.
PeterK. is offline   Reply With Quote
Old 25th October 2018, 09:46   #7
Pawel
Moderator
 
Pawel's Avatar
 
Join Date: Aug 2004
Location: Poland
Posts: 518
Send a message via ICQ to Pawel
OK. Should be OK. Images should be sharp and beautiful :P
-Pawel
Pawel is offline   Reply With Quote
Old 25th October 2018, 18:41   #8
PeterK.
Quinto Black CT Developer
 
Join Date: Sep 2016
Posts: 569
I still have a question.

In the Winamp Information Report there is the Legend footnote explaining the colors and their corresponding list. For example, my skin is green in this list because I currently use it. Good.

But what about reducing those five color combinations into one? So I do not have to remember which color represents which list. Especially for first time users it might me a little bit confusing to see a plug-in text line in red as if it was missing or corrupt.

What do you think?
PeterK. is offline   Reply With Quote
Old 25th October 2018, 19:25   #9
Pawel
Moderator
 
Pawel's Avatar
 
Join Date: Aug 2004
Location: Poland
Posts: 518
Send a message via ICQ to Pawel
Thanks for opinion.
This can not be changed, it is done on purpose. Legend is based on colors and I like it.
Of course, red color can be changed into another color, more neutral... What color would you propose?

-Pawel
Pawel is offline   Reply With Quote
Old 25th October 2018, 20:18   #10
PeterK.
Quinto Black CT Developer
 
Join Date: Sep 2016
Posts: 569
Quote:
Originally Posted by Pawel View Post
... What color would you propose?
Hmmmm ... We can mix 16 millions colors - which one should we take?

1) not red - means danger, warning, something is missing or kaput
2) not pink - it is ugly
3) dark yellow is already in use ...

Take this one: 8D428E
PeterK. is offline   Reply With Quote
Old 25th October 2018, 22:03   #11
Pawel
Moderator
 
Pawel's Avatar
 
Join Date: Aug 2004
Location: Poland
Posts: 518
Send a message via ICQ to Pawel
Here are the new colors: http://www.meggamusic.co.uk/shup/1540501379/su.png

App: http://www.meggamusic.co.uk/shup/1540501299/WAABout.exe

-Pawel
Pawel is offline   Reply With Quote
Old 27th October 2018, 09:15   #12
PeterK.
Quinto Black CT Developer
 
Join Date: Sep 2016
Posts: 569
Quote:
Originally Posted by Pawel View Post
Here are the new colors ...
Much better ...

Another short question: some text lines are bold while others are not. Is there a hidden rule for such usage? What about making all text lines not bold?

Attached Thumbnails
Click image for larger version

Name:	bold.jpg
Views:	88
Size:	398.4 KB
ID:	54152  
PeterK. is offline   Reply With Quote
Old 27th October 2018, 19:25   #13
Pawel
Moderator
 
Pawel's Avatar
 
Join Date: Aug 2004
Location: Poland
Posts: 518
Send a message via ICQ to Pawel
No. It is just how I designed it. It can be changed via CSS rules. There will be more CSS styles in future (perhaps one of them will use no-bold for all data text).
-Pawel
Pawel is offline   Reply With Quote
Old 29th October 2018, 10:24   #14
Pawel
Moderator
 
Pawel's Avatar
 
Join Date: Aug 2004
Location: Poland
Posts: 518
Send a message via ICQ to Pawel
As I promised I was working on adding new css styles to report files. Now it supports 4 styles (default, winamp2, winamp5 and wacup).

The newest build: http://www.meggamusic.co.uk/shup/1540808506/WAAbout.exe

New Report CSS Styles:
- Winamp 2: http://www.meggamusic.co.uk/shup/154...6/WINAMP2.html
- Winamp 5: http://www.meggamusic.co.uk/shup/154...1/WINAMP5.html
- WACUP: http://www.meggamusic.co.uk/shup/1540808572/WACUP.html

I hope you like it.
-Pawel
Pawel is offline   Reply With Quote
Old 29th October 2018, 16:04   #15
PeterK.
Quinto Black CT Developer
 
Join Date: Sep 2016
Posts: 569
Well done Pawel.
PeterK. is offline   Reply With Quote
Old 8th January 2019, 13:14   #16
Pawel
Moderator
 
Pawel's Avatar
 
Join Date: Aug 2004
Location: Poland
Posts: 518
Send a message via ICQ to Pawel
First post of this thread has been updated.
Now, you can test Winamp Backup & Restore (WABackupRestore) application. It allows you to create backup of all Winamp files and settings and if it is neccessary restore it.

Applications are in beta stage.
Enjoy!
-Pawel
Pawel is offline   Reply With Quote
Old 8th January 2019, 22:16   #17
MrSinatra
Forum King
 
MrSinatra's Avatar
 
Join Date: Dec 2004
Location: WKPS, State College
Posts: 5,438
Send a message via AIM to MrSinatra
Will give it a spin later...

PENN STATE Radio or http://www.LION-Radio.org/
--
BUG #1 = Winamp skips short tracks
Wish #1 = Multiple Column Sorting
Wish #2 = Add TCMP/Compilation editing
MrSinatra is offline   Reply With Quote
Reply
Go Back   Winamp & Shoutcast Forums > Winamp > Winamp Discussion

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ump